Amphenol's Trading Volume Drops 49.89% to $419 Million, Ranks 239th in Market
On April 11, 2025, Amphenol's trading volume was $419 million, a 49.89% decrease from the previous day, ranking 239th in the day's stock market. AmphenolAPH-- (APH) rose 1.98%.
UBS analyst Joseph Spak has revised the price target for Amphenol (APH) shares, reducing it from $90 to $78, while maintaining a Buy rating. This adjustment comes as part of a broader reassessment of the company's prospects in the current macroeconomic environment.
Goldman Sachs has also lowered its price target for Amphenol, reducing it from $89 to $72. The firm maintains a Buy rating on the shares, citing reduced expectations for the auto industry, which is a significant sector for Amphenol's business.
Analysts have set 12-month price targets for Amphenol, with an average target of $87.00, a high estimate of $102.00, and a low estimate of $72.00.
